Jet constituents provide a more complete description of the radiation pattern inside a jet than observables describing the global jet properties like the number of tracks or the jet width. An approach to tag quark- and gluon-initiated jets using their constituents (Particle Flow Objects) reconstructed in ATLAS is presented. Monte Carlo simulations of proton–proton collisions at center of mass energy of 13 TeV are used. Transformer architectures are used to learn long-range dependencies between jet constituent kinematic variables. Several variations of transformers are studied, and their performance is compared to taggers based on global jet properties and other jet constituent taggers. A new Deep Learning architecture (DeParT) is presented, slightly outperforming other networks. All models are evaluated on simulated data from multiple Monte Carlo generators to study their model-dependence.

Framework for the development of deep neural networks for jet identification. Jet identification is the task of classifying jets as originating from either quarks or gluons.
Framework for the calibration of quark-gluon taggers using data from the ATLAS experiment. The calibration is done using the matrix method and the novel jet topics method. The repository is only accessible for ATLAS members.
